The National Security Sector within Leidos is seeking a PostgreSQL Database Administrator with strong systems, software, cloud, and Agile experience to support the Passenger Systems Program Directorate (PSPD) within Customs and Border Protection (CBP). PSPD supports the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) and CBP critical missions, specifically screening and processing travelers at the ports of entry (POEs) into the United States.
In this hands-on position, you will work collaboratively to architect, design, build, deliver, and enhance highly available, scalable, real-time systems. You will exercise your judgment in determining and recommending the best designs based on customer business objectives, timelines and other resource constraints. You will participate in and/or direct major deliverable of projects through all aspects of the software development life cycle including scope and work estimation, architecture and design, coding and unit and integration testing.
**This position REQUIRES the candidate to be in Ashburn, VA, 2 times a week**
Primary Responsibilities:
- Performs technical planning, system integration, verification and validation, cost and risk, and support ability and effectiveness analyzes.
- Designs and implements database schemas and structures according to project requirements.
- Develops and maintains documentation for database environments, including data standards and procedures.
- Plans for storage requirements and database growth, and scale infrastructure as needed.
- Collaborates with developers to optimize queries, stored procedures, and database design for applications.
- Must be a self-starter, strong leader, and the ability to work independently with little supervision.
- BS/BA degree and 13+ years of prior relevant DBA experience or Masters with 10+ years of prior relevant DBA experience; OR 4 years of experience in lieu of degree
- 4+ years' experience tuning Aurora PostgreSQL database performance and PL/pgSQL scripts to optimize performance
- 4+ years' experience as an AWS Aurora PostgreSQL DBA in a 24x7 environment managing multiple databases of over 70TB.
- Individual must have at least 4+ years' experience as an Oracle DBA in a 24x7 environment supporting databases of over 200TB
- Proficiency in tuning Oracle Databases and troubleshooting performance issues.
- Able to support on-call schedule and incident resolution.
- Proficiency with Microsoft Office Products (Word, Excel, Visio, & PowerPoint)
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ills
- U.S. Citizen.
- Must be able to maintain and obtain a CBP Background Investigation prior to start
- Migration of Oracle to Aurora PostgreSQL with over 70TB migrating from Oracle to Aurora
- Experience using Generative AI to tune SQL statements
- Experience with CBP
- Java Experience
- Experience with other AWS data related services
- Experience with any of the following: Struts, Hibernate, Java, JSF, Swing, JavaScript, Bootstrap, Angular.
- Experience with CI/CD, SecDevOps, Git source code repository (GitLab, GitHub)
